2019 AutoMobility LA Hackathon
There is a continuing focus on investments that support electric charging infrastructure and transportation. These investments help accelerate a more sustainable future for states, local communities, and commerce while influencing the way businesses and consumers alike access and prioritize their mobility options.
Over the course of two days, hackathon participants were asked to develop the enabling software and architectures to support an electric charging infrastructure for electric vehicles and long-haul, electric trucks as they travel along the 1,300 miles of Interstate 5 from Mexico to Canada. Participants in the challenge sought development opportunities to integrate Los Angeles city data, use of Alexa skill(s), the AWS Connected Vehicle Reference Architecture (CVRA 2.0), HERE Location Services (geocoding/search, fleet telematics, map data, navigation, routing), and SiriusXM Connected Vehicle Services drive, location and crash incident data. The event was MCed by Bryan Biniak, CEO & Founder of ConnectedTravel.

The Challenge
Participants in the hackathon will be challenged to develop solutions that support:
Smart-charging journey planning (ML for most convenient station, predict availability, advance scheduling, and reservation) including integrated payments
Battery performance and analytics and calculating range based upon driving style
Improving the in-vehicle experience (e.g. using Alexa for Automotive)
Use vehicle and location data to create models for predicting either: driving range based on driving style or impact/damage modeling based on real-time vehicular data
